Phillip C. Parker, 75, a quiet professional of Plymouth, passed away on Wednesday (July 22, 2020) at Sharon S. Richardson Community Hospice Facility in Sheboygan Falls.
He was born in Waukesha on July 20, 1945, a son of the late George and Frieda (Tuhl) Parker. After graduating from Plymouth High School, Phillip received his teaching degree. He furthered his education at the University of Wisconsin – Madison and Lakeland College,
earning his Master’s Degree of Education.
Phillip taught at Chilton High School and later at Rufus King and James Madison high schools in Milwaukee. Upon his retirement he returned to Plymouth where he enjoyed his farm. He also enjoyed traveling and was very active in the GOP, and his student governments while teaching.
